One of the primary advantages of 8.7/15kV aluminum power cables is their lightweight nature. Aluminum, being significantly lighter than copper, allows for easier handling and installation. This can lead to reduced labor costs and faster project timelines, as the installation process can be more efficient. Furthermore, aluminum cables offer excellent conductivity, which is enhanced when compared to their weight, making them an ideal choice for various electrical applications.
In terms of construction, 8.7/15kV aluminum power cables typically consist of several key components: the conductor, insulation, and protective sheath. The conductor is made of aluminum strands, which provide the necessary electrical conductivity. Surrounding the conductor is an insulating layer that protects against electrical leakage and environmental factors. This insulation is often made from cross-linked polyethylene (XLPE) or ethylene propylene rubber (EPR), both of which offer excellent thermal properties and resistance to moisture and chemicals.
Protection is further enhanced through a robust outer sheath designed to provide mechanical strength and environmental resistance. This sheath ensures that the cable can withstand harsh conditions, making it suitable for outdoor installations, underground applications, or in areas prone to physical stresses.
Additionally, the 8.7/15kV aluminum power cables are often designed to meet various industry standards and regulations, ensuring safety and reliability in electrical installations. These standards might include compliance with international specifications, which can vary depending on the region and application. Adhering to these standards is essential for ensuring that the cables perform optimally and maintain longevity in their operational life.
Usage scenarios for 8.7/15kV aluminum power cables include power distribution networks, renewable energy projects, and substations. Their versatility and durability make them suitable for both overhead and underground cable systems. Moreover, they are increasingly employed in renewable energy applications, such as wind and solar power installations, due to their favorable weight and conductivity characteristics.
